A Mud Hog will do you more good than duals will in mud, at least in our soil types. In '04 when things got really muddy here guy's were not very impressed with how their duals worked. One guy who mudded out alot of acres switched his 9610 from duals to 30.5x32 rice tires, he lost some flotation but gained alot of traction. If your wanting more flotation you might look at a 900/60R32 tire, it will fit on the same rim as a 30.5 but it's the same size as a 35.5x32 and will have almost the same surface area as 18.4x38 duals or about 40% more than 30.5x32 bias ply tires.
